import type { APICallError, ModelMessage } from "ai"
import { unique } from "remeda"
import type { JSONSchema } from "zod/v4/core"
import type { Provider } from "./provider"
export namespace ProviderTransform {
function normalizeMessages(msgs: ModelMessage[], model: Provider.Model): ModelMessage[] {
if (model.api.id.includes("claude")) {
return msgs.map((msg) => {
if ((msg.role === "assistant" || msg.role === "tool") && Array.isArray(msg.content)) {
msg.content = msg.content.map((part) => {
if ((part.type === "tool-call" || part.type === "tool-result") && "toolCallId" in part) {
return {
...part,
toolCallId: part.toolCallId.replace(/[^a-zA-Z0-9_-]/g, "_"),
}
}
return part
})
}
return msg
})
}
if (model.providerID === "mistral" || model.api.id.toLowerCase().includes("mistral")) {
const result: ModelMessage[] = []
for (let i = 0; i < msgs.length; i++) {
const msg = msgs[i]
const nextMsg = msgs[i + 1]
if ((msg.role === "assistant" || msg.role === "tool") && Array.isArray(msg.content)) {
msg.content = msg.content.map((part) => {
if ((part.type === "tool-call" || part.type === "tool-result") && "toolCallId" in part) {
// Mistral requires alphanumeric tool call IDs with exactly 9 characters
const normalizedId = part.toolCallId
.replace(/[^a-zA-Z0-9]/g, "") // Remove non-alphanumeric characters
.substring(0, 9) // Take first 9 characters
.padEnd(9, "0") // Pad with zeros if less than 9 characters
return {
...part,
toolCallId: normalizedId,
}
}
return part
})
}
result.push(msg)
// Fix message sequence: tool messages cannot be followed by user messages
if (msg.role === "tool" && nextMsg?.role === "user") {
result.push({
role: "assistant",
content: [
{
type: "text",
text: "Done.",
},
],
})
}
}
return result
}
// DeepSeek: Handle reasoning_content for tool call continuations
// - With tool calls: Include reasoning_content in providerOptions so model can continue reasoning
// - Without tool calls: Strip reasoning (new turn doesn't need previous reasoning)
// See: https://api-docs.deepseek.com/guides/thinking_mode
if (model.providerID === "deepseek" || model.api.id.toLowerCase().includes("deepseek")) {
return msgs.map((msg) => {
if (msg.role === "assistant" && Array.isArray(msg.content)) {
const reasoningParts = msg.content.filter((part: any) => part.type === "reasoning")
const hasToolCalls = msg.content.some((part: any) => part.type === "tool-call")
const reasoningText = reasoningParts.map((part: any) => part.text).join("")
// Filter out reasoning parts from content
const filteredContent = msg.content.filter((part: any) => part.type !== "reasoning")
// If this message has tool calls and reasoning, include reasoning_content
// so DeepSeek can continue reasoning after tool execution
if (hasToolCalls && reasoningText) {
return {
...msg,
content: filteredContent,
providerOptions: {
...msg.providerOptions,
openaiCompatible: {
...(msg.providerOptions as any)?.openaiCompatible,
reasoning_content: reasoningText,
},
},
}
}
// For final answers (no tool calls), just strip reasoning
return {
...msg,
content: filteredContent,
}
}
return msg
})
}
return msgs
}
function applyCaching(msgs: ModelMessage[], providerID: string): ModelMessage[] {
const system = msgs.filter((msg) => msg.role === "system").slice(0, 2)
const final = msgs.filter((msg) => msg.role !== "system").slice(-2)
const providerOptions = {
anthropic: {
cacheControl: { type: "ephemeral" },
},
openrouter: {
cache_control: { type: "ephemeral" },
},
bedrock: {
cachePoint: { type: "ephemeral" },
},
openaiCompatible: {
cache_control: { type: "ephemeral" },
},
}
for (const msg of unique([...system, ...final])) {
const shouldUseContentOptions = providerID !== "anthropic" && Array.isArray(msg.content) && msg.content.length > 0
if (shouldUseContentOptions) {
const lastContent = msg.content[msg.content.length - 1]
if (lastContent && typeof lastContent === "object") {
lastContent.providerOptions = {
...lastContent.providerOptions,
...providerOptions,
}
continue
}
}
msg.providerOptions = {
...msg.providerOptions,
...providerOptions,
}
}
return msgs
}
export function message(msgs: ModelMessage[], model: Provider.Model) {
msgs = normalizeMessages(msgs, model)
if (model.providerID === "anthropic" || model.api.id.includes("anthropic") || model.api.id.includes("claude")) {
msgs = applyCaching(msgs, model.providerID)
}
return msgs
}

export function maxOutputTokens(
npm: string,
options: Record<string, any>,
modelLimit: number,
globalLimit: number,
): number {
const modelCap = modelLimit || globalLimit
const standardLimit = Math.min(modelCap, globalLimit)
if (npm === "@ai-sdk/anthropic") {
const thinking = options?.["thinking"]
const budgetTokens = typeof thinking?.["budgetTokens"] === "number" ? thinking["budgetTokens"] : 0
const enabled = thinking?.["type"] === "enabled"
if (enabled && budgetTokens > 0) {
// Return text tokens so that text + thinking <= model cap, preferring 32k text when possible.
if (budgetTokens + standardLimit <= modelCap) {
return standardLimit
}
return modelCap - budgetTokens
}
}
return standardLimit
}
export function schema(model: Provider.Model, schema: JSONSchema.BaseSchema) {
/*
if (["openai", "azure"].includes(providerID)) {
if (schema.type === "object" && schema.properties) {
for (const [key, value] of Object.entries(schema.properties)) {
if (schema.required?.includes(key)) continue
schema.properties[key] = {
anyOf: [
value as JSONSchema.JSONSchema,
{
type: "null",
},
],
}
}
}
}
*/
// Convert integer enums to string enums for Google/Gemini
if (model.providerID === "google" || model.api.id.includes("gemini")) {
const sanitizeGemini = (obj: any): any => {
if (obj === null || typeof obj !== "object") {
return obj
}
if (Array.isArray(obj)) {
return obj.map(sanitizeGemini)
}
const result: any = {}
for (const [key, value] of Object.entries(obj)) {
if (key === "enum" && Array.isArray(value)) {
// Convert all enum values to strings
result[key] = value.map((v) => String(v))
// If we have integer type with enum, change type to string
if (result.type === "integer" || result.type === "number") {
result.type = "string"
}
} else if (typeof value === "object" && value !== null) {
result[key] = sanitizeGemini(value)
} else {
result[key] = value
}
}
// Filter required array to only include fields that exist in properties
if (result.type === "object" && result.properties && Array.isArray(result.required)) {
result.required = result.required.filter((field: any) => field in result.properties)
}
return result
}
schema = sanitizeGemini(schema)
}
return schema
}
